Gerrard happy with Wembley return

Liverpool captain Steven Gerrard was happy with how his side handled a "physical" display from Stoke City to book their place in the FA Cup semi-finals.

The Reds defeated the Potters 2-1 at Anfield to secure a second appearance at Wembley Stadium this season following February's Carling Cup final victory over Cardiff City.

"Stoke are a tough physical side and Tony Pulis had them wound up because it was very big game for both sides today," Gerrard told ITV Sport.

"It was even-stevens in the first half but in the second half we took over and controlled the game. Stewie [Downing] took his goal fantastically well and off we go to Wembley again."

The Merseysiders will face either Sunderland or local rivals Everton for a place in May's final.
